7. Invisalign Vivera Retainers

Invisalign Vivera retainers are post-treatment retainers made by Align Technology, the same company behind Invisalign clear aligners. Unlike every other provider on this list, you cannot order teeth retainer online directly from Vivera without a dental provider involved. If you finished Invisalign treatment and want to stay within the same ecosystem, Vivera is the natural continuation.

Best for

Vivera works best for patients who completed Invisalign treatment and want a retainer manufactured by the same company using the same technology. It also suits anyone whose orthodontist or dentist already has their digital scan on file from treatment, which removes the impression step entirely.

How ordering works

Your dentist or orthodontist places the Vivera order on your behalf through Align Technology's system. If your digital scan is already on file, the process moves quickly. If not, your provider takes a new intraoral scan during an office visit before submitting your order.

What you get and material details

Vivera retainers are made from a proprietary thermoplastic material that Align Technology claims is significantly stronger than competing clear retainer materials. Each order typically includes four sets of retainers, giving you extras to replace worn-out appliances over time.

Receiving multiple sets upfront lowers your long-term cost per retainer, but you pay a higher price at the point of purchase.

Pricing, shipping, and turnaround

Vivera retainers typically cost $400 to $1,000 or more depending on your provider's fees. Turnaround runs one to two weeks after your provider submits the order.

Guarantees and support

Warranty and support go through your dental provider, not Align Technology directly. If a retainer cracks or fits poorly, your provider handles the resolution.

Key things to know before you order

  • You cannot order Vivera retainers independently without a licensed provider.
  • The higher price point reflects the multi-set packaging and brand premium.
  • Vivera is best suited to patients already connected to an Invisalign-trained provider.
